Is 676 101 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 676 101 is about 822.254.

Thus, the square root of 676 101 is not an integer, and therefore 676 101 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 676 101?

The square of a number (here 676 101) is the result of the product of this number (676 101) by itself (i.e., 676 101 × 676 101); the square of 676 101 is sometimes called "raising 676 101 to the power 2", or "676 101 squared".

The square of 676 101 is 457 112 562 201 because 676 101 × 676 101 = 676 1012 = 457 112 562 201.

As a consequence, 676 101 is the square root of 457 112 562 201.
